The History of Teflon and PFOA: A Troubled Past

Teflon, a brand name for polytetrafluoroethylene (PTFE), revolutionized cookware with its non-stick properties. Developed by DuPont in the 1930s, it quickly became a kitchen staple. However, the manufacturing process involved perfluorooctanoic acid (PFOA), a chemical that has since raised significant health and environmental concerns.

PFOA was used as a processing aid in the production of Teflon. It did not become part of the final product but was released into the environment during manufacturing. Studies linked PFOA exposure to various health problems, including certain cancers, thyroid disorders, and developmental issues. This led to widespread concerns about the safety of Teflon cookware, even though the finished product contained negligible amounts of PFOA.

The Environmental Protection Agency (EPA) took action, leading to a phase-out of PFOA by major manufacturers, including DuPont (now Chemours). This phase-out was largely completed by 2015. The legacy of PFOA, however, continues to influence public perception of Teflon.

The Transformation of Teflon: PFOA-Free Manufacturing

The most significant change in Teflon production is the elimination of PFOA. Current Teflon cookware is manufactured using alternative processing aids, primarily GenX chemicals. While some concerns have been raised about the safety of GenX, current evidence suggests they are less persistent in the environment and less bioaccumulative than PFOA.

It’s important to note that the chemical composition of PTFE itself has not changed significantly. The non-stick properties that make Teflon desirable remain the same. The critical difference is the elimination of the concerning processing aid, PFOA.

Understanding GenX Chemicals

GenX chemicals are a group of per- and polyfluoroalkyl substances (PFAS) used as replacements for PFOA in Teflon manufacturing. They are designed to have shorter carbon chains, theoretically reducing their persistence in the environment and their ability to accumulate in living organisms.

While research is ongoing, preliminary studies suggest that GenX chemicals may still pose some health risks, although likely less severe than those associated with PFOA. Further research is needed to fully understand their potential long-term effects.

Is Teflon Cookware Safe in 2024? The Current Scientific Consensus

The overwhelming consensus among scientists and regulatory agencies is that Teflon cookware manufactured today is safe for everyday use, provided it is used correctly. The elimination of PFOA has significantly reduced the potential health risks associated with Teflon.

However, it’s crucial to understand the proper usage guidelines to avoid potential problems. Overheating Teflon cookware can cause the PTFE coating to break down, releasing fumes that can be harmful, particularly to birds. It’s important to use Teflon cookware at low to medium heat settings and avoid preheating empty pans for extended periods.

Potential Risks of Overheating Teflon

When Teflon cookware is overheated, it can release polymer fumes, including perfluoroisobutene (PFIB), which can cause flu-like symptoms known as “polymer fume fever.” These symptoms are usually temporary and resolve within 24-48 hours, but they can be more severe in individuals with pre-existing respiratory conditions.

To prevent overheating, it’s recommended to use Teflon cookware at temperatures below 500°F (260°C). Never leave an empty pan on a hot burner, and ensure adequate ventilation when cooking with Teflon.

Scratched or Damaged Teflon: A Cause for Concern?

If Teflon cookware is scratched or damaged, small particles of PTFE can potentially flake off into food. While PTFE is generally considered inert and non-toxic when ingested, some experts recommend replacing scratched or damaged cookware as a precaution.

There is no conclusive evidence that ingesting small amounts of PTFE poses a significant health risk. However, it’s best to err on the side of caution and avoid using cookware with significant damage to the non-stick coating.

Alternatives to Teflon Cookware: Exploring Safer Options

For those who remain concerned about the potential risks of Teflon, even in its PFOA-free form, there are several alternative cookware options available. These options offer different advantages and disadvantages in terms of performance, durability, and cost.

  • Stainless Steel: A durable and versatile option that is generally considered safe and non-reactive.
  • Cast Iron: A classic choice known for its heat retention and durability. Can be seasoned to create a natural non-stick surface.
  • Ceramic Cookware: Often marketed as a non-toxic alternative to Teflon. However, some ceramic coatings may contain PFAS.
  • Glass Cookware: A safe and non-reactive option that is suitable for baking and some stovetop cooking.

The choice of cookware ultimately depends on individual preferences and priorities. It’s important to research the materials used in different types of cookware and consider the potential health and environmental implications.

Is Teflon cookware still made with PFOA in 2024?

No, Teflon cookware manufactured in 2024 should not contain PFOA (perfluorooctanoic acid). PFOA was used in the manufacturing process of Teflon for decades, but due to health concerns, it was phased out by major manufacturers in the mid-2010s. This phase-out was largely completed by 2015, and current regulations in many regions strictly prohibit its use in the production of non-stick cookware.

However, it’s still crucial to be aware of older cookware you may already own. If you have Teflon pans purchased before 2015, they may still contain traces of PFOA. While the risk of exposure from these older pans is generally considered low with proper use and care, it’s a good idea to consider replacing them with newer, PFOA-free options for added peace of mind.

What health risks are associated with Teflon cookware?

The primary health concerns historically associated with Teflon cookware stemmed from PFOA, used in its production. PFOA exposure has been linked to various health issues, including certain types of cancer (kidney and testicular), thyroid disorders, liver damage, and immune system effects. However, as mentioned earlier, PFOA is no longer used in the manufacturing process of Teflon cookware.

The current potential risk associated with Teflon cookware arises if it is overheated to very high temperatures (above 500°F or 260°C). When overheated, the Teflon coating can break down and release fumes, which may cause temporary flu-like symptoms known as “polymer fume fever.” These symptoms are usually mild and resolve within 24-48 hours. To avoid this, it’s essential to use non-stick cookware at moderate temperatures and avoid leaving empty pans on a hot burner.

How can I safely use Teflon cookware?

To safely use Teflon cookware, it’s crucial to adhere to a few simple guidelines. First, avoid overheating the pan, never exceeding 500°F (260°C). Always use medium to low heat settings when cooking with Teflon. Furthermore, never leave an empty pan on a hot burner, as this can quickly lead to overheating and the release of fumes.

Second, ensure proper ventilation when cooking with Teflon. Opening a window or using a range hood can help to dissipate any fumes that may be released, although this is primarily a concern when pans are overheated. Finally, use utensils made of wood, silicone, or plastic to avoid scratching the non-stick coating. Scratched Teflon pans should be discarded as the underlying metal might be exposed.

Does scratching Teflon cookware make it unsafe to use?

Scratched Teflon cookware presents a potential, albeit generally low, risk. When the non-stick coating is scratched, the underlying metal may be exposed. If the metal is aluminum, small amounts of aluminum could leach into food during cooking. While aluminum toxicity is a concern at very high levels, the amount that typically leaches from scratched cookware is considered minimal.

However, it’s still advisable to replace scratched Teflon cookware. The exposed metal can also affect the non-stick properties of the pan, leading to food sticking and requiring more oil or butter. Furthermore, damaged cookware is more likely to release particles of Teflon into food, although these particles are generally considered inert and pass through the body without being absorbed. For peace of mind and optimal cooking performance, replacing scratched cookware is the best approach.
